Antique Lover's Books in Order

See the Antique Lover's books by Deborah Morgan in order, with short summaries, series background, and a clear guide to where to start with Jeff Talbot.

Publication Order

Sort:

5 books

Death is a Cabaret

by Deborah Morgan

2001

Former FBI agent Jeff Talbot heads to Mackinac Island chasing a rare French cabaret set once made for Napoleon's Josephine. When rival collectors start dying, his antiques hunt turns into a murder case with too many suspects and one very deadly prize.

The Weedless Widow

by Deborah Morgan

2002

Jeff Talbot's fishing trip turns grim when his friend Bill Rhodes is murdered and a cache of valuable antique lures disappears. Tracing the stolen pieces to an online auction draws Jeff into a tighter trap when the killer kidnaps his agoraphobic wife.

The Marriage Casket

by Deborah Morgan

2003

Jeff thinks he's landed a bargain when a nephew offers up his late aunt's antiques. Then a bloodstain and an old marriage casket full of letters point to murder, buried family secrets, and a killer who wants the past left alone.

Four on the Floor

by Deborah Morgan

2004

When Jeff goes to collect his restored 1948 Chevy woodie, he finds four bodies in the shop, including a man from his FBI past. An envelope of clues pulls him into a family-linked mystery and a dangerous undercover hunt.

The Majolica Murders

by Deborah Morgan

2006

Jeff asks fellow picker Lanny to find some majolica for his wife's birthday, then watches him get arrested for murdering a dealer. To clear his friend's name, Jeff has to untangle a shady sale, a quiet man, and a dangerous history.
